Hot Search
No search results found
- Write an article
- Post discussion
- Create a list
- Upload a video
Peter Duffell was born on July 10, 1922 in Canterbury, Kent, England, UK. He was a director and writer, known for BBC2 Playhouse (1973), The Avengers (1961) and Man in a Suitcase (1967). He was married to Rosslyn Audrey Cliffe and ??. He died on December 12, 2017 in the UK.